A RESOLUTION OF THE MIAMI CITY COMMISSION AUTHORIZING THE FUNDING
OF THE POLICE ATHLETIC LEAGUE PROGRAM, TO ASSIST WITH EXPENSES
RELATED TO THE OPERATION OF THE PROGRAM FROM APRIL 15, 2015,
THROUGH JUNE 15, 2015 IN AN AMOUNT NOT TO EXCEED $10,000..00;
ALLOCATING FUNDS FROM THE LAW ENFORCEMENT TRUST FUND, AWARD
NO, 1019, PROJECT NUMBER 19-690002, ACCOUNT CODE NO,
12500,191602.883000.0000, WITH SUCH EXPENDITURES HAVING BEEN
APPROVED BY THE CHIEF OF POLICE AS COMPLYING WITH THE. UNITED
STATES DEPARTMENT OF JUSTICE'S "GUIDE TO EQUITABLE SHARING FOR
STATE AND LOCAL LAW ENFORCEMENT AGENCIES."
WHEREAS, the United States Department of Justice's "Guide to Equitable Sharing for State
and Local Law Enforcement Agencies" ("Guide"), authorizes the expenditure of forfeiture cash or
proceeds for certain law enforcement purposes; and
WHEREAS, the police department, through the Police Athletic League ("P.A,L"), is committed
to the education and development of the youth of our community ("Program"); and
WHEREAS, the Program is designed to focus on the prevention of juvenile delinquency and
steers youngsters clear of violent and other destructive behaviors through the use of educational and
athletic activities; and
WHEREAS, a budget was submitted detailing how these funds will be used to cover some
expenditures of the Program from April 15, 2015 through June 15, 2015; and
WHEREAS, the Chief of Police has recommended adoption of this resolution and has
determined that the expenditures proposed comply with the United States Department of Justice's
Guide;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to the provisions of the United States Department of Justice's Guide, the
recipient, P.A.L. shall: 1) certify that funds appropriated will be used lawfully and for the purpose
stated; 2) maintain proper accounting records for the expenditure of such monies; and 3) provide any
reports, including but not limited to audit reports, as may be required by the City of Miami or applicable
law;
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COMMISSION OF THE CITY OF MIAMI,.
FLORIDA:
Section 1. The recitals and findings contained in the Preamble to this Resolution are hereby
adopted by reference and incorporated as if fully set forth in this Section,
Section 2, The funding of the P.A,L. Program ("Program"), to assist with expenses related to
the operation of the Program from April 15, 2015 through June 15, 2015, in an amount not to exceed

$10,000.00, is authorized, with funds allocated from the Law Enforcement Trust Fund, Award No.
1019, Project Number 19-690002, Account Code No. 12500.191602.883000.0000, with such
expenditures having been approved by the Chief of Police as complying with United States
Department of Justice's "Guide to Equitable Sharing for State and Local Law Enforcement Agencies."
Section 3. This Resolution shall become effective Immediately upon its adoption and signature
of the Mayor (1}

Footnotes:
{1} If the Mayor does not sign this Resolution, it shall become effective at the end of ten (10)
calendar days from the date it was passed and adopted. If the Mayor vetoes this Resolution, it
shall become effective immediately upon override of the veto by the City Commission.
